American Emergent National Literature

This volume presents a selection of texts written by relevant white (Crevecoeur, Franklin, Jefferson) and black (Wheatley, Equiano) authors during the final years of the eighteenth— century. Their writings represent the spirit of the Enlightenment and explore the meaning and central role of what it was to be an American at the Revolution and early Republic eras.
